The Future of Welding in an AI Driven Economy: Why Skilled Welders Still Matter

Artificial intelligence is changing the way industries plan, design, inspect, and produce work. Welding is part of this shift, but the future of welding is not as simple as machines replacing people. In many areas, AI and automation will support welders by improving productivity, quality control, training, and inspection. At the same time, skilled human welders will continue to matter because welding requires judgment, safety awareness, adaptability, and real world problem solving.
AI Is Changing Work, Not Ending Work

The AI economy is creating real concern, but the best available labour market research points to transformation rather than simple elimination. The World Economic Forum’s Future of Jobs Report 2025 projects that job disruption will affect the equivalent of 22% of jobs by 2030. The same report also projects 170 million new roles and 92 million displaced roles, creating a net increase of 78 million jobs. For welding, this means the conversation should not be framed as “AI versus welders.” A better question is: what skills will help welders work confidently in a more automated and data driven industry?

Where AI and Automation Already Support Welding

AI and automation can support welding in several ways. Robotic welding can help with repetitive production welds. Digital welding machines can support more consistent parameters. Sensors and imaging tools can assist with inspection and quality tracking. Software can help plan production, identify defects, and improve documentation. These tools are valuable, especially in manufacturing environments where the same weld is repeated many times. However, they still depend on trained people to set up equipment, understand the material, monitor quality, and respond when conditions change.

Why Skilled Welders Still Matter

Welding is physical, technical, and situational. A welder may need to adjust for fit up, joint preparation, heat distortion, material thickness, position, accessibility, weather, safety hazards, and inspection requirements. These are not always predictable from a screen. In field welding, repair work, custom fabrication, construction, and tight access environments, human judgment remains a major part of quality work. A robot may repeat a weld, but a skilled welder reads the job, understands the risk, and adjusts based on what is actually happening in front of them.

Canada Still Needs Skilled Tradespeople

Canadian labour market data supports the importance of skilled trades. Job Bank lists the national wage range for welders at $22.00 to $47.00 per hour, with a median wage of $30.00 per hour. Alberta shows a higher median wage of $38.00 per hour. Job Bank also reports a moderate risk of shortage for production welders from 2024 to 2033, with 90,900 workers employed in 2023 and 26% of workers aged 50 and over. These numbers show that welding remains connected to long term workforce needs, especially as older workers retire and industries continue to require skilled labour.

The Skills Future Welders Should Build

Future ready welders should focus on more than one process. MIG, TIG, STICK, and FCAW each have different applications across shop, field, manufacturing, repair, and fabrication work. New welders should also build confidence with safety procedures, basic drawings, measurement, joint preparation, welding positions, defect awareness, and testing expectations. In an AI driven economy, the strongest welders will be the ones who combine hands on ability with technical awareness and the willingness to keep learning.

What This Means for New Welding Students

For students, the rise of AI should not be viewed only as a threat. It should be seen as a reason to build strong practical foundations. Machines can assist with parts of the work, but they do not replace the need to understand heat, metal, movement, safety, and quality. Students who train seriously, practice consistently, and understand the standards expected in the industry will be better prepared for the modern welding environment.
